Follow-up Comment #2, bug #44467 (project octave):

Thanks for your reply.
Both glxinfo, glxgears work as expected
LIBGL_DEBUG=verbose glxgears
Running synchronized to the vertical refresh.  The framerate should be
approximately the same as the monitor refresh rate.
302 frames in 5.0 seconds = 60.263 FPS

while after running octave (with or without --no-gui)
LIBGL_DEBUG=verbose ./run-octave
plot(1:10)
libGL: screen 0 does not appear to be DRI3 capable
libGL: screen 0 does not appear to be DRI2 capable
libGL: OpenDriver: trying /usr/lib64/dri/tls/swrast_dri.so
libGL: OpenDriver: trying /usr/lib64/dri/swrast_dri.so
libGL: Can't open configuration file /home/<user>/.drirc: No such file or
directory.
libGL: Can't open configuration file /home/<user>/.drirc: No such file or
directory.
libGL error: No matching fbConfigs or visuals found
libGL error: failed to load driver: swrast

Forcing the wrong library path before running glxgears yield the same error:
LD_LIBRARY_PATH=/usr/lib64/:$LD_LIBRARY_PATH glxgears
libGL error: No matching fbConfigs or visuals found
libGL error: failed to load driver: swrast
Running synchronized to the vertical refresh.  The framerate should be
approximately the same as the monitor refresh rate.
363 frames in 5.3 seconds = 68.253 FPS
Side note: while the refresh rate is about the same, in this case, the
animation is jerky.
